DEBATING THE STARS IN THE ITALIAN RENAISSANCE WITH OVANES AKOPYAN

In this episode we talk with Ovanes Akopyan, post-doctoral researcher at the University of Innsbruck. He has recently published the book with his PhD research: Debating the Stars in the Italian Renaissance. Giovanni Pico Della Mirandola’s Disputationes Adversus Astrologiam Divinatricem and Its Reception (Leiden; Boston: Brill, 2020). In the podcast we discuss his research into the role of Giovanni Pico Della Mirandola in the anti-astrological debate as well as other aspects of early modern history of science.
